Through 2 periods tonight, Corey Perry has scored 3 goals to reach the 50 goal mark. He also has an assist to move into 2nd place in the scoring race with 97 points, only 3 points behind Daniel Sedin.
All along Perry's name has rarely been mentioned in MVP discussions. But he's been red hot the past 2 months. Not only is he running away with the Richard Trophy, but he's in striking distance of the Art Ross as well. Anyone think he has a chance of winning the Hart?

I think it applies to both evenly to be honest. Both Perry and Daniel benefit from a similar supporting cast.
Getzlaf could probably win an art ross, if he could actually play a full season with that line - he's only had 1 full season in the last 4, where he scored 91 points. He is consistently over PPG in production.
Ryan is the other part of that line, and is the least consistent of all 3 - he goes for long periods of time with nothing, and the breaks out for 10 points in a week. But he's still good for 70 points a year, and has 71 so far this year.
I see the ANA and VAN lines as being very similar - 2 awesome and one mediocre (relatively mediocre that is) on each one: Sedin/Sedin and mediocre Burrows for VAN, Getzlaf/Perry and mediocre Ryan on ANA. If anything, I would think Perry has a better supporting cast, given that Ryan is miles better than Burrows. |
